Blender - Forsyth, MO SUMMARY: Prepare different formulas in order to manufacture nutritional supplements. There will be opportunities for cross-training in the Encapsulation Department, Tableting Department, and the Packaging Department.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ES : Management retains the discretion to add to or change the duties of this position at any time. Consistent attendance is critical to the successful performance of this role. Essential duties include, but are not limited to, the following: Assist Blending Team Lead. Read and comprehend Blending Bill of Material Sheets. Properly read and comprehend raw ingredient names and lot numbers. Properly weigh and document batch and lot numbers from raw material onto Bill of Material Sheets. Properly prepare and clean barrels for use in Blending. Operate and read floor and table top scales. Charge and discharge powder from 60V and 20V mixers. Clean the Blending room and all machines and utensils associated with the Blending area. Support production in maintaining the cleanliness of the production rooms as needed. Properly clean and prepare machines for the next formula of powder. Remove, clean and reinstall proper change parts on production equipment to expedite subsequent operations. Maintain a safe and clean work environment. Ensure proper PPE is utilized. While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to stand; use hands to finger, handle or feel objects, tools, or controls; and talk or hear. The employee frequently is required to walk and reach with hands and arms. The employee is occasionally required to sit and twist, stoop, kneel and crouch.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ision and color vision. Occasionally required to climb stairs or portable stairs. Repetitive hand movements are required. Personal Protection Equipment is required including a forced air respirator. The employee must be able to lift up to 50 pounds and move up to 2500 pounds with the appropriate equipment. When loading the barrels for mixing, the employee is required to load up to 480 pounds for the 60V Mixer and up to 160 pounds for the 20V Mixer.
